This evaporation boat must be used in a vacuum environment and matched to the source holder geometry. Electrical ratings must be verified against the power supply, and the maximum operating temperature must not exceed 1200°C.
- Vacuum Environment: Operate the boat only within a vacuum chamber to prevent oxidation and ensure proper resistive heating.
- Geometry Compatibility: Confirm that the boat overall dimensions, tub geometry, and tub capacity match the evaporation source holder before installation.
- Electrical Matching: Verify that the power supply voltage (1.47 V), current (204 A), and power (300 W) ratings match the boat specifications.
- Temperature Limit: Do not exceed the maximum rated temperature of 1200°C during operation to avoid material degradation.
Follow these steps to install the evaporation boat in a vacuum deposition system. Ensure all electrical and mechanical connections are secure before applying power.
Required Equipment: Vacuum deposition system, Resistive heating power supply, Evaporation source holder
- Inspect Boat
Inspect the boat for physical damage, deformation, or contamination before installation. - Mount Boat
Mount the boat securely into the evaporation source holder, ensuring proper alignment of the tub with the source material. - Connect Power Supply
Connect the power supply leads to the boat terminals, verifying correct polarity and tight connections. - Verify Electrical Ratings
Verify that the power supply voltage, current, and power settings match the boat's rated values of 1.47 V, 204 A, and 300 W. - Evacuate Chamber
Evacuate the vacuum chamber to the required base pressure before applying power to the boat. - Apply Power Gradually
Apply power gradually to heat the boat to the desired evaporation temperature, not exceeding 1200°C. - Monitor Temperature
Monitor the boat temperature continuously during operation to prevent exceeding the maximum limit.

Which dimensions and geometry features are critical for ensuring the tungsten evaporation boat fits the evaporation source holder?
Critical dimensions include thickness (0.2 mm), width (15 mm), length (100 mm), tub length (40 mm), tub depth (2.3 mm), and tub capacity (0.8 cc). The boat has a step-type geometry with a flat tub and down step 5.7. These parameters must be matched to the source holder and mating components to ensure proper installation and compatibility.
